Let's Demonstrate How You Can Become a Bank
Say your child just graduated from college and landed a great job. H/she wants to finance a car purchase for $15,000; but it will require you to co-sign for the note. The loan terms are as follows:
Loan Amount: $15,000
Bank Rate: 7.45%
Repayment Term: 48 months
Monthly Payment: $362.33
You have two options:
1: Co-Sign for the Note:
you can co-sign for the auto loan and let your child make the monthly payments as scheduled. The bank will earn all of the interest paid on the loan.
If your child misses a payment or two, your credit record will reflect that (since you are the co-borrower).
If your child fails to make scheduled payments, the bank will require you to make the payments.
2: You can use your BLOC to Finance the Auto:
You can use your BLOC to finance the auto. Your child will be responsible to you for the monthly payments. All of the interest on the loan will be coming to you.
In the event your child misses a payment or two, your credit record is protected since your income deposits are constantly paying your BLOC account.
If your child fails on the loan, you are in a better position since you will be paying your BLOC instead of the bank.
